The Gyeongju Cherry Blossom Festival will be held from the 31st of this month to the 2nd of next month around Daereungwon Stone Wall Road and Bonghwangdae Square.
The Gyeongju Cherry Blossom Festival was canceled in 2020 and 2021 due to the spread of COVID-19, and last year it was held online in a non-face-to-face format, leaving many tourists who were looking forward to the festival disappointed.
The biggest feature of this festival, held for the first time in four years, is its transformation into a sustainable festival focusing on eco-friendliness and pet-friendliness using cherry blossoms as the theme. During the Cherry Blossom Festival, various programs such as performances (Cherry Blossom Street Art), ESG activities (Cherry Blossom Jogging, Cherry Blossom Doggy Playground), spatial productions (Cherry Blossom Mung, Cherry Blossom Light & Cherry Blossom Shower), and experiences (free photo printing, Cherry Blossom Limited) are prepared.
Cherry Blossom Jogging is part of the ESG activity sector and includes a program that exchanges paper or plastic takeout cups for eco-friendly wooden cups, as well as a plogging event where participants pick up trash while enjoying the cherry blossoms.
The Cherry Blossom Doggy Playground is a pet-friendly space where visitors can enjoy with their dogs. It offers welfare services such as pet registration and health consultations, and operates a dog playground and flea market. However, only one dog per guardian is allowed entry, and it is the only event held at Bonghwangdae Square during the festival.
Cherry Blossom Mung is a healing resting area on the road where cherry blossoms scatter, providing a space to fully enjoy and relax with Cherry Blossom Street Art, food trucks, flea markets, and art experience zones. Cherry Blossom Light & Cherry Blossom Shower is an emotional space where visitors can take photos of the cherry blossoms. During the event period, a free photo printing event is also held for visitors to take home memories.
Gyeongju City operates a festival citizen SNS supporters group and a university student cherry blossom planning team to increase participation not only from tourists but also from Gyeongju citizens. Traffic in all directions will be restricted around Daereungwon Stone Wall Road (from Hwangnam Bread Intersection to Cheomseongdae Intersection) during the festival period.
Mayor Ju Nak-young of Gyeongju said, “The full-fledged cultural tourism of Gyeongju begins with the blooming of cherry blossoms,” and added, “We hope you come to Gyeongju, where spring flowers and cultural heritage harmonize, and enjoy the full spring atmosphere while being showered by cherry blossoms.”
